As you mentioned before, some want to produce lateral branches, others just want to grow straight up. Two of the seed groups produced most of the plants with the early tendency for laterals. The range of development within each seed group is quite interesting. Not just with the tendency for and extent of development of side branches, but also in caudex color and in leaf size, color and shape.

I'm assuming flower size, color and shape will also vary quite a bit as well when the time comes.
